Not At Home

I forced my eyes open. It was all just a dream, right? One bad nightmare. It was dark. Nighttime, I guess. I was fine. I was safe. In a few hours Pa will be asking what I got up to last night. What did I get up to last night? I was at the party. Great party, 'til everyone started getting drunk. That's when I left with my small can of vodka. I'd wandered around a bit, no real sense of direction of where I was going. I think I ended up at the train station. I frowned. No, that couldn't be right. That was part of my dream. The dream where I'd been kidnapped from the train station-

I rushed to sit up, hitting my head on something hard. I winced, feeling around in the dark. They'd been a blanket on top of me that was not my own. I began panicking. No. It had all been a dream. This wasn't real. This couldn't be real. I tried to get out, only to find mesh all the way around. I was caged in. This wasn't home at all.
